首页产品库评测行情新闻|手机数码笔记本台式机DIY硬件数字家庭数码相机办公外设|软件下载游戏开发|社区

更多

数码相机
MP4
LCD
机箱
音箱

软件资讯设计 工具 系统 开发 安全 办公 陶吧 IT教育 Vista频道 | 下载中心酷我音乐盒 腾讯QQ
天极网 > 开发频道>GIS三维地景仿真设计之最后的话

GIS三维地景仿真设计之最后的话

2006-08-10 08:00作者:青岛郎锐出处:天极开发责任编辑:方舟

  返回GIS系统三维地景仿真设计教程汇总页

  引言

  通过前面给出的五篇技术文章,已经围绕对地景的真实感三维仿真这一最终目标以DEM数字高程模型和OpenGL各种主要技术向读者简要介绍了OpenGL基本程序框架的一般搭建、对DEM数字高程模型的使用、对三维场景的建模、与地景模型的人机交互以及对雾化与纹理等高级技术的使用等一系列知识点。通过对本系列文章的阅读,读者不仅能够掌握一般的GIS三维仿真处理程序的基本设计思想和具体的处理过程,还能够结合具体的程序实例对其中用到的各种OpenGL技术有一个更深刻的认识。本文下面还要从应用的角度对前面开发出来的地景三维仿真程序进行介绍。

  示例程序介绍

点击放大此图片

  上图展示的应用程序界面即为根据前面5篇文章所介绍的内容而设计出来的"DEM数字高程网格数据三维地景仿真系统"软件。该软件提供了对DEM数据的管理功能、对显示模式的选择功能、漫游控制功能、地景设置功能、以及对环境和纹理的设置等主要功能。其中,对DEM数据的管理功能包括了对DEM数据的新建、打开、保存等常规功能也提供了对DEM网格间距的调整等特殊功能。这里主要用到的是在本系列第二篇文章中介绍过的对DEM数据使用的相关内容。

  对显示模式的选择功能主要提供了对正射投影和透视投影这两种投影方式的选择以及对以点、线、面三种建模方式的选择切换,这部分功能主要建立在本系列第三篇文章中介绍的相关内容基础上。除此之外,环境设置中的材质设置功能也是建立在该文章内容基础上的。

  为了能够提供方便的多视角、任意观察距离的实景观察仿真效果,这里除了提供包含旋转、平移和缩放等基本几何变换的鼠标、键盘全景漫游功能之外,还提供了对地景高差系数的控制功能,这部分功能的实现过程在第四篇文章中有详细的介绍。

  软件的雾化功能和纹理设置功能可以最大程度的为软件提供真实感地景仿真效果。尤其是纹理设置功能的提供可以使用户只通过更换同一地区不同用途的纹理位图而实现对同一个DEM数据资源的重复利用,能够充分利用其中的资源。这部分内容的实现过程主要体现在第五篇文章的相关论述中。现在读者不妨将前几篇文章重新阅读一番,并从整体上重新去把握,相信不难设计出类似的三维地景仿真程序。

关注此文的读者还看过:

返回开发频道首页

共3页。 123下一页

软件频道最新更新

热点推荐

IT嘉年华

编辑推荐

软件下载

热门
推荐

网友关注

软件
资料
游戏

装机推荐

文章排行

本周
本月
最新更新
天极服务|关于我们|About us|网站律师|RSS订阅|友情合作|加入我们|天极动态|网站地图|意见反馈|MSN/QQ上看天极
Copyright (C) 1999-2012 Yesky.com, All Rights Reserved 版权所有 天极网络